Default Sound Problem with DC758D

Go the box yesterday, install went OK, records nicely, works OK, except I have a sound problem.

There is a constant humming noise on all the channels, some are so bad you cannot hear the program. I have an old SONY Trinitron TV (KV-32V68). I have tried the internal speakers and speakers through my make shift sound system, same results. Have tried all the sound options that are offered by the TV and the PVR, same results.

I have tried every thing to get rid of the humming, short of calling SHAW, but no luck. Anyone having the same problem, or is it my TV. TV worked great with the old Moto Digital Terminal, no sound problems.

Quote:
Originally Posted by altdan View Post
There is a constant humming noise on all the channels.... TV worked great with the old Moto Digital Terminal, no sound problems.
Sounds like a possible 'ground loop' that could be caused by either a broken cable or a cable not pushed in all the way. Recheck all your connections and be sure they also all go to the correct terminals. Try a different set of cables too, if you have some.

I tried a couple different codes from Harmony on my universal remote (motorola and pace codes) and on both it appears that the skip button is skipping ahead in 1 minute intervals instead of 30 sec on the motorolas. Is this normal for Pace devices or is it due to the extra storage space (1TB)??

Have you checked the 'Configuration' info to see what your settings are?

To see the info, press Menu twice, Setup, Cable Box Setup, Configuration, OK, then press the FAV button 6 times.

The title at the top should read: ---Software Filtering---
R/H Column should show:
DVR Skip Fwd1: 30
DVR Skip Fwd2: 300
DVR Skip Back1: 15
DVR Skip Back2: 300

If your Skip Fwd1 shows '60' then you are correct that it is set to skip ahead one minute. I don't know of any other boxes that do this at this time. Please confirm your configuration for the rest of us.
